------------------------- UNIX HOST LOST ITS MEMORY ------------------------- Our Sun SPARC 1000 UNIX host (mail.bcpl.net) has lost half of its RAM, reducing available RAM to 128 MB. This may sound like a lot to most PC and Mac users, but on a UNIX computer handling the kind of load ours does it is a crippling malfunction. We expect a technician from Sun Microsystems to be on site tomorrow (Friday, Sep 4) to work on the SPARC 1000. In the mean time, you should expect poor response time during PPP logins, Unix logins, mail sends and receives, DNS lookups, browsing of Web pages hosted on our server, and in dozens of other services provided by the SPARC 1000. We regret the inconvenience, and hope the SPARC 1000 will be back to normal soon. -------------------------------------------------------------------- PLEASE DO NOT REPLY TO THIS MESSAGE!
